This detail view of the front of the Thorny Rock Candy Shop shows the nine-light display window we made for the project, along with our handmade, custom-planted window box, fitted with a variety of dried (real) and artificial flowers and plants. As a mini wreath maker, this one almost took care of itself—I have tons of tiny floral materials on hand for little projects like this!
